The invasion of India by Alexander the Great as described by Arrian, Q. Curtius, Diodoros, Plutarch and Justin; / Marcus Junianus Justinus, Plutarch, Siculus Diodorus, Quintus Curtius Rufus, Arrian, John Watson McCrindle.
Comprised of translations from the works of various classical authors, this 1896 work describes Alexander's campaigns in Afghanistan, the Punjâb, Sindh, Gedrosia and Karmania.
